Best places to live in Lincolnshire
30 towns ranked by overall liveability score, from official UK data.
This ranking covers the 52 Lincolnshire towns above 3,000 people that we can score in at least 8 of 9 categories, with the best 30 listed. The top two are all but level: Scunthorpe on 64/100, Bourne on 63. Across all 52 qualifying towns the county median is 49.5/100, 4.5 points below the 54/100 median for UK towns of this size.
On price, Grimsby is the top five's cheapest at a median of £137,000. Bourne, also in the top five, runs to £245,500. Bourne's second place leans heavily on one category: lifestyle, at 94/100 against a national town median of 21/100, far further ahead of the norm than its healthcare, the next strongest. Across the 30 towns listed, scores run from 64 down to 49, a 15-point spread. Category-by-category detail is on the pages for Scunthorpe, Bourne and North Hykeham.

Ranked on the default weighting, out of 100. Strongest categories are the two furthest above the national median for that category, not simply the two highest numbers. Almost every town scores well on safety, so raw highs would say little.

How this ranking was built
Every settlement in Lincolnshire was scored across 9 categories (safety, schools, healthcare, transport, environment, broadband, lifestyle, economic health and bills) from official sources including Police UK, Ofsted, the CQC, Ofcom, the Environment Agency and MHCLG. Two filters then decide who appears here:
- Population above 3,000. Without a floor the list fills with hamlets of a few dozen people. Lincolnshire has 52 towns above it.
- Real data in at least 8 of 9 categories. Places we can only partly measure are excluded rather than ranked on guesswork.
Counties are ceremonial, and a town belongs to the county its postcodes physically sit in, so border towns land where residents would expect them to.
